2016-02-23 76 views
0

Drupal 7,Bootstrap主題。 工具提示不起作用。Drupal中的Bootstrap工具提示

  • 工具提示和智能的形式描述在主題設置中啓用
  • HTML似乎確定
  • 工具提示應該有額外的JS

HTML

<input tabindex="2" class="form-control form-text" title="Enter something or leave blank 
for random" data-toggle="tooltip" type="text" id="edit-short-url" name="short_url" value="" 
size="6" maxlength="128" /> 

JS被激活

<script> 
    $(document).ready(function() { 
     $("body").tooltip({ selector: '[data-toggle=tooltip]' }); 
    }); 
</script> 

See the page here

我在做什麼錯?

回答

0

您已經包括jquery version - v1.4.4這是過時其中Twitter的引導不使用/支持的一種方式。同樣,如果你會注意到你的瀏覽器控制檯,你會發現以下錯誤,這很清楚地解釋了這個問題。

  • Uncaught Error: Bootstrap's JavaScript requires jQuery version 1.9.1 or higher

隨後

  • Uncaught TypeError: $ is not a function

  • Uncaught TypeError: $(...).on is not a function

下載的jquery.js的最新版本,目前的最新是v2.2.1截至02/24/2016並參考它而不是v1.4.4這將解決上述問題。

+1

工程就像一個魅力!謝謝! – Ivan

+0

隨時隨地..快樂編碼.. :) –